Influence of eye movements, auditory perception, and phonemic awareness in the reading process

Laura Megino-Elvira, Pilar Martín-Lobo and Esperanza Vergara-Moragues

The Journal of Educational Research, 2016, vol. 109, issue 6, 567-573

Abstract: The authors' aim was to analyze the relationship of eye movements, auditory perception, and phonemic awareness with the reading process. The instruments used were the King-Devick Test (saccade eye movements), the PAF test (auditory perception), the PFC (phonemic awareness), the PROLEC-R (lexical process), the Canals reading speed test, and the ACL-1 (reading comprehension). The sample was composed of 52 first-year primary school pupils. After the correlational analysis, results indicate that all of these factors correlate in reading (lexical process, speed, and word comprehension). Moreover, the nonparametric Mann-Whitney U test reveals that children with saccade eye movements and auditory perception problems obtain lower reading levels. In addition, children with lexical problems obtain a lower level of phonemic awareness. Given the importance of these variables, the authors conclude with a proposal of neuropsychological activities to improve reading skills.
